Comparison of legacy and next-generation Hatteland Technology computer platforms.
| Feature / Component | Legacy: HTB30 Series | Next-Gen: HTB40 Series | Key Upgrade / Difference |
|---|---|---|---|
| Processor CPU |
HTB30 6th Gen Intel® Skylake
|
HTB40 12th Gen Intel® Alder Lake
|
Major upgrade Massive increase in physical cores and multi-threading capabilities, moving from 6th Gen to 12th Gen architecture. |
| Memory RAM |
Max 32GB Dual Channel DDR4-2133 |
Max 64GB Dual Channel DDR5-4800 |
Double the memory capacity and significantly faster DDR5 data transfer speeds. |
| Graphics GPU | Intel® HD Graphics 510 / 520 | Intel® Iris® Xe or Intel® UHD | Vastly improved graphical rendering for heavier ECDIS, radar and automation applications. |
| Max Displays | Up to 3 independent displays | Up to 4 independent displays | HTB40 natively supports one additional display monitor. |

| Max Resolution | 4096 × 2304 @ 60Hz via DP | 7680 × 4320 @ 60Hz via DP | HTB40 supports 8K video output, future-proofing high-resolution console setups. |
| Storage Options |
1 × M.2 SATA SSD Up to 960GB |
2.5" SATA SSD up to 1.9TB or M.2 SATA / NVMe Long-depth model features 2 × removable SSD bays |
HTB40 offers higher capacities, faster NVMe support and removable drive bays on the long-depth model. |

| Ethernet LAN |
4 × Gigabit LAN 2 × Intel, 2 × Realtek |
4 × Gigabit LAN 2 × Realtek, 1 × Intel i226IT, 1 × Intel i219V |
Both offer 4× gigabit teaming support, but HTB40 uses newer Ethernet controllers. |
| Security TPM | TPM 2.0 integrated | TPM 2.0 integrated | Both series provide hardware-based security via TPM 2.0, essential for modern Windows OS compliance. |
| HT IO Modules |
Supports standard Hatteland interface modules CAN, NMEA COM, DIO, etc. |
Supports standard Hatteland interface modules CAN, NMEA COM, DIO, etc. |
Both generations support the same versatile range of Hatteland Technology IO modules, ensuring interface compatibility for existing setups. |
| Power Inputs |
Dual 24VDC, short depth Some AC models existed |
Dual 24VDC, short depth Multi-power AC/DC or single AC, long depth |
Both maintain robust isolated dual inputs with automatic switching. |
| Form Factor | Short and long depth models available |
Short and long depth models available Form fit to HTB30 |
Same ultra-compact, fully enclosed aluminium fanless footprint, allowing for 1-to-1 physical replacement. |
